diff options
author | Jon Marius Venstad <venstad@gmail.com> | 2021-10-19 12:26:53 +0200 |
---|---|---|
committer | Jon Marius Venstad <venstad@gmail.com> | 2022-01-11 10:31:10 +0100 |
commit | 86120cb18cdaf4e0bc8ab05f0c9206cc439ac014 (patch) | |
tree | f71006baf0089b47c8e7ae64605ef52c714d299d /zookeeper-server/zookeeper-server-common/src | |
parent | e3d4838bf5cdd6e058b56b6e424f34ffe958d4ff (diff) |
Do not die when reconfiguring to a single server
Diffstat (limited to 'zookeeper-server/zookeeper-server-common/src')
-rw-r--r-- | zookeeper-server/zookeeper-server-common/src/main/java/com/yahoo/vespa/zookeeper/Reconfigurer.java | 4 |
1 files changed, 0 insertions, 4 deletions
diff --git a/zookeeper-server/zookeeper-server-common/src/main/java/com/yahoo/vespa/zookeeper/Reconfigurer.java b/zookeeper-server/zookeeper-server-common/src/main/java/com/yahoo/vespa/zookeeper/Reconfigurer.java index 8b46c67e0f6..3305ae80fba 100644 --- a/zookeeper-server/zookeeper-server-common/src/main/java/com/yahoo/vespa/zookeeper/Reconfigurer.java +++ b/zookeeper-server/zookeeper-server-common/src/main/java/com/yahoo/vespa/zookeeper/Reconfigurer.java @@ -87,10 +87,6 @@ public class Reconfigurer extends AbstractComponent { // TODO jonmv: unit test this private void reconfigure(ZookeeperServerConfig newConfig) { Instant reconfigTriggered = Instant.now(); - // No point in trying to reconfigure if there is only one server in the new ensemble, - // the others will be shutdown or are about to be shutdown - if (newConfig.server().size() == 1) shutdownAndDie(Duration.ZERO); - String newServers = String.join(",", servers(newConfig)); log.log(Level.INFO, "Will reconfigure ZooKeeper cluster." + "\nServers in active config:" + servers(activeConfig) + |